Gathering Your Materials
Before you start, make sure you have all the necessary materials. Here’s a list of what you’ll need:
- Fresh pumpkins (choose ones with a smooth surface)
- Acrylic paints (a variety of colors)
- Paintbrushes (various sizes)
- Pencil
- Eraser
- Paper towels or rags
- Newspaper or drop cloth
- Optional: stencils, markers, or other decorative items
Preparing Your Pumpkins
To ensure your painted Halloween pumpkins last throughout the season, proper preparation is key.
1. Choose the Right Pumpkins: Select pumpkins that are firm and have a smooth surface. Avoid those with soft spots or blemishes.
2. Clean the Surface: Wipe the pumpkins with a damp cloth to remove any dirt or debris. Allow them to dry completely before painting.
3. Optional: Seal the Pumpkins: For added durability, you can seal the pumpkins with a clear sealant. This step is optional but can help prolong the life of your painted designs.
Designing Your Pumpkins
The design phase is where your creativity can shine. Here are some tips to help you get started:
1. Sketch Your Design: Use a pencil to lightly sketch your design on the pumpkin. This will serve as a guide for your painting.
2. Choose a Theme: Decide on a theme for your painted Halloween pumpkins. Popular themes include spooky ghosts, witches, and jack-o’-lanterns.
3. Use Stencils: If you’re not confident in your freehand skills, consider using stencils. They can help you achieve precise and intricate designs.
Painting Your Pumpkins
Now comes the fun part—painting your pumpkins! Follow these steps for a flawless finish:
1. Base Coat: Apply a base coat of paint to your pumpkin. This will help your design stand out and provide a smooth surface for your artwork.
2. Layering Colors: Use multiple layers of paint to build depth and dimension. Allow each layer to dry completely before adding the next.
3. Detail Work: Use smaller brushes for detailed work. This is where you can add intricate patterns and designs to make your pumpkins truly unique.
4. Sealing Your Design: Once your pumpkin is completely dry, apply a clear sealant to protect your design from moisture and wear.

Maintaining Your Painted Halloween Pumpkins
To ensure your painted Halloween pumpkins last throughout the season, follow these maintenance tips:
1. Avoid Direct Sunlight: Prolonged exposure to sunlight can cause the paint to fade. Place your pumpkins in a shaded area when possible.
2. Keep Them Dry: Moisture can damage the paint and cause the pumpkin to rot. Keep your pumpkins in a dry location.
3. Regular Inspection: Check your pumpkins regularly for any signs of damage or wear. Touch up any areas as needed.
